Elder and Disability Advocacy

6654 Chippewa St Saint LouisMO63109
Map

Open Map

Description

Elder and Disability Advocacy is located at 6654 Chippewa St, Saint Louis, MO..
by merchantcircle on July 08, 2015 from merchantcircle